Floodplains by design is an ambitious, public private partnership led by ecology and the bonneville environmental foundation. floodplains by design works to accelerate integrated efforts to reduce flood risks and restore habitat along washington's major river corridors.
Resources Floodplains By Design Floodplains by design works to reduce flood risk, restore habitat, improve water quality, support agriculture, and enhance recreation along washington’s rivers. Fbd coordinates state and federal funding for local solutions, facilitates integrated floodplain management, and supports large scale, multiple benefit projects that protect, restore, and improve the resiliency of floodplains across the state.
